Minister of Oil and Gas of the Government of National Unity, Mohamed Aoun, has welcomed Saudi Arabia's decision to extend the voluntary reduction of its oil production by one million barrels per day.

Aoun stressed, in a statement, that the decision is a positive step for the balance of the market between global producers and consumers, and also for the global economy in general, according to the ministry's Facebook post.

Saudi Press Agency quoted a source at the Saudi’s Ministry of Energy as saying that Saudi Arabia will extend the production cut, which it began implementing in July, for another month, to include the month of August, with the possibility of extending it further, in order to "enhance the precautionary efforts made by the OPEC Plus countries, with the aim of supporting the stability and balance of oil markets.’
